
Jacobs University Bremen weather features a temperate maritime climate influenced by the North Sea, with mild temperatures year-round and frequent rainfall. Average highs reach 18°C (64°F) in summer and drop to 4°C (39°F) in winter, while lows average -1°C (30°F) to 12°C (54°F). Annual precipitation totals around 760 mm (30 inches), spread over about 170 rainy days, making umbrellas essential. Extremes include summer peaks up to 35°C (95°F) and winter dips to -12°C (10°F). This climate supports comfortable outdoor activities most of the year but requires preparation for wind and wet conditions. Seasonal shifts at Jacobs University Bremen bring varied conditions that influence campus life and studies. Winters (Dec-Feb) are cool and damp with averages of 2°C (36°F), occasional frost, and short days, prompting indoor-focused routines and higher heating costs. Springs (Mar-May) warm to 12°C (54°F) with blooming greenery, ideal for campus walks. Summers (Jun-Aug) offer pleasant 18-22°C (64-72°F) days, perfect for outdoor lectures, though rare heatwaves may require hydration. Falls (Sep-Nov) turn rainy and windy, averaging 10°C (50°F), testing waterproof gear.

Bremen sits at sea level (11m altitude) on flat North German Plain geology, with no volcanoes or seismic activity. Air quality is excellent, averaging AQI 30-50 (good), PM2.5 at 9µg/m³ yearly, thanks to green policies. Low pollution supports health for students and faculty at Jacobs University Bremen. The university provides air monitors and sustainability programs. Wind from the Weser River adds freshness but can carry pollen. Bremen faces low-moderate risks, mainly floods from Weser River (every 5-10 years) and winter storms. Rare droughts or severe freezes occur. No wildfires or earthquakes.
| Hazard | Frequency | University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Floods | Occasional | Evacuation plans, alerts |
| Storms | Winterly | Shelters, early closures |
| Heatwaves | Rare | Cooling centers |
